See what the hair iron from heaven did to my crazy curly hair! And I have comparison shots for what the Hai and Chi did to my hair for reference.
Pic #1: Hello, crazy curly hair! You're looking rather big and sassy today! Yes, my hair is quite big and the curls are rather small, and clearly, my hair is an even bigger pain to straighten. Sometimes it was just easier to let the hair do what it wants. This is my hair doing what it wants in May of this year.
Pic #2: This is the evil doing of the Chi and this is 4 years ago. Yes, it's technically straight, but it's technically dead, too. Not only does my hair look dry and brittle, (it was, in fact, dry and brittle) but also note how thin my hair is there. Ironing my hair with that evil iron thinned out my hair tremendously. Don't mind the brassy hair, I thought I could pull off light brown in high school. It just brassed up. to the Chi. Straightening time: 50 minutes. Why? Because I had to do sections over and over and over again. That was definitely great for my hair.
Pic #3: A bitsy better than Chi, but not by much. This is the work of the Hai and while it's not as damaging as the Chi was (note how my hair became thick again) but my hair still looks dry and a bit frizzed. Here, I'm the girl at the party that everyone knows has curly hair but she straightened it and now it looks a mess. Don't you love that girl? Straightening time: 40 minutes.
Pic #4: Hello, beautiful hair! I didn't know you existed atop my head unless I went to an aerosol smelling cavern where I paid a woman with strong upper arms to blow you dry with a round brush and some hot hair. It's so shiny and straight, and not dry or weird looking. My boyfriend's response: "I could never rationalize spending $200 on something like a hair iron, but oh my God, you're hair is so shiny and soft, that thing was worth it." Straightening time: 25 minutes. Please note that my hair is way longer than Chi days and longer than Hai days too, and despite that, GHD takes less time.
Pic #5: And a close up of my hair! I had no idea my brown hair was so multi-tonal! I just thought my hair was dark! I love you GHD, I wouldn't trade you for the world!
